If you've spent money on attorney fees or court costs related to a claim of unlawful discrimination, you may be able to claim a deduction for those expenses on the tax return that you file with TaxAct.
To use TaxAct to claim a deduction for fees related to an unlawful discrimination case:
In the Federal Quick Q&A Topics screen, click Other Adjustments > Other adjustments.
On the Other Adjustments - Miscellaneous screen, scroll down to the Qualified attorney fees paid after 10/22/2004 for unlawful discrimination field, then enter the appropriate amount.
Click Continue.
